I need help with this problem, if anyone could help ASAP, that would be much appreciated. In the figure below, mROP = 125° Find
VARVARA [1.3K]

Answer:

mRP = 125°

mQS = 125°

mPQR = 235°

mRPQ = 305°

Step-by-step explanation:

Given that

  • mROP = 125°
  • ∠ROP is a central angle

Then:

  • measure of arc RP, mRP = mROP = 125°

Given that

  • ∠QOS and ∠ROP are vertical angles

Then:

  • mQOS = mROP = 125°
  • measure of arc QS, mQS = mROP = 125°

Given that

  • ∠QOR and ∠SOP are vertical angles

Then:

  • mQOR = mSOP

Given that

  • The addition of all central angles of a circle is 360°

Then:

mQOS + mROP + mQOR + mSOP = 360°

250° + 2mQOR = 360°

mQOR = (360°- 250°)/2

mQOR = mSOP = 55°

And (QOR and SOP are central angles):

  • measure of arc QR, mQR = mQOR = 55°
  • measure of arc SP, mSP = mSOP = 55°

Finally:

measure of arc PQR, mPQR = mQOR + mSOP + mQOS = 55° + 55° + 125° = 235°

measure of arc RPQ, mRPQ = mROP + mSOP + mQOS = 125° + 55° + 125° = 305°

The Big Falcon Rocket (BFR or Starship) from Space X can carry approximately 220,000 pounds. If they only carried $100 bills, ho
kifflom [539]

Answer:

$9,979,032,100 or $9.979 billion

Step-by-step explanation:

The approximate weight of a $100 bill is 1 gram.

All of the calculations bellow assume that the volume of the bills would not be an issue and only concerns weight.

1 pound is equivalent to approximately 453.59237 grams.

The weight in grams that the Big Falcon Rocket can carry is:

W= 220,000*453.59237=99,790,321.4\ g

Since each bill weighs 1 gram, the number of bills it could carry, rounded to nearest whole bill is 99,790,321. The total amount it could carry is:

A=99,790,321*\$100=\$9,979,032,100
